Transaction 28dcebb31e6978540f37c515f5d036b205bd94712e8decfac2acd9af14e928eb

37 Input
2 Outputs
  • 28dcebb31e6978540f37c515f5d036b205bd94712e8decfac2acd9af14e928eb:0
  • value  138846
    address  32XmcgLYvq3YDKzvLMKja1PN4YEVzJrdBL
  • 28dcebb31e6978540f37c515f5d036b205bd94712e8decfac2acd9af14e928eb:1
  • value  73000
    address  1FikKMfyrH4dkQ3RxVTsL46rLhDWRdjcSw